Output 356eb5385e54667a219c7b94dfa5527311f264b8afecacf3e089a1a9f3d6e0ab:3

value
305984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64e8b1ae92627abf1de9b5ed6d20a88cc62190a2 OP_EQUAL
address
3AtaFbRDPfP46gkUhRZ9QZc78F7Jqwv1p5
transaction
356eb5385e54667a219c7b94dfa5527311f264b8afecacf3e089a1a9f3d6e0ab
spent
true